Vedere l'offerta completa

SOFTWARE ENGINEER

Descrizione dell'offerta di lavoro

About the job   Want to join a motivated team of 220+people who are dedicated to improving patient care through surgical robotics? Interested in working in the fast-paced medical device industry? Medical Microinstruments Inc is looking for people with a passion for innovation and a dedication to excellence.
At MMI we are building the future of microsurgery.
The Symani platform provides the surgeon with the capability to operate on a small scale with ease and precision, thanks to the Symani platform and a variety of Instrument types.
For our R&D Department, we are looking for a Software Engineer.
The successful candidate must excel in a high-energy, small team environment, be able to drive to solutions from rough requirements, and have a commitment to high quality level, working in a growing company of med-tech industry at an early commercial starting point.
Roles&Responsibilities   Design and implement embedded medical device software to enhance the feature set of a teleoperated robot used for microsurgery.
Together with system architecture software design, other responsibilities include the acquisition and processing of digital images in real-time, the network communication between robot and other devices, and the implementation of UI components.
Ensure that the code is robust, documented, thoroughly tested, meets requirements, and conforms to coding guidelines and standards.
The software development life cycle follows IEC Work on a cross-functional team to develop new features in a complex, distributed, hierarchical system.
Other activities include helping perform formal risk analysis and develop and verify software mitigations.
Develop SW tool to support testing, system diagnostics and product service.
He/She will work closely with other senior technical team members to ensure that system software requirements/designs meet overall system requirements.
Requirements.
Master’s degree in engineering or Computer Science, Automation or related+5 years of experience in robotics or embedded systems required, medical devices preferred Experience in software development from concept to production required Experience in version control, Bug Tracking, monitoring, Continuous Integration and Deployment tools required Proficiency in C++ required Experience in Python for data analysis preferred Experience with real-time operating systems (RTOS) such as QNX or Linux-RT preferred Experience in formal Architectural Design, Analysis and Testing of SW preferred Experience with IEC software life cycle preferred Experience in web services such as AWS or Microsoft Azure preferred Understanding of computer graphics and computer vision algorithms, including Machine Learning and Deep Learning techniques, will be considered a plus Good communication, documentation and team working skills Excellent English written and oral communications skills Ability to work autonomously and collaboratively in a fast-paced environment Excellent project management skills and proven ability to multi-task while respecting deadlines.
About MMI MMI is dedicated to improving reconstructive options for surgeons and patients and has developed the first teleoperated robotic platform for open microsurgery.
It offers the surgeon motion scaling and tremor elimination and aims to facilitate existing procedures as well as enable new ones in the domain of microsurgery, from post-oncological and trauma reconstructions to ophthalmology, organ transplantation and pediatric surgery.
What we offer An exciting and challenging role based in Pisa, Italy.
Working in a fun and growing company that is dedicated to improving patient care.
The chance to learn new skills under the direction of experienced colleagues with career advancement opportunities.
Join Us Are you seeking an opportunity to make a real difference in a med-tech company with the aim of improving patient care? Join us and grow with a team of energy people who will motivate and inspire you! Interested? We would love to hear from you!   MMI is committed to creating a diverse work environment and is proud to be an equal opportunity employer.
Employment decisions are made without regard to race, color, religion, national or ethnic origin, sex, sexual orientation, gender identity or expression, pregnancy, age, disability or other characteristics protected by law.
Vedere l'offerta completa

Dettagli dell'offerta

Azienda
  • Medical Microinstruments
Località
  • Tutta l'Italia
Indirizzo
  • Imprecisato - Imprecisato
Tipo di Contratto
  • Imprecisato
Data di pubblicazione
  • 10/12/2024
Data di scadenza
  • 10/03/2025
Embedded Software Developer / Software Engineer (M/F)
Baumann sideloaders srl

Per la sede di cavaion veronese cerchiamo un/a: embedded software developer / software engineer (m/f) la persona sarà inserita nel nostro team di ricerca e sviluppo e gradualmente responsabilizzata nella gestione di commesse e progetti di innovazione... le principali attività saranno le seguenti:......

Software Engineer
Adami & associati selezione del personale

Ruolo: software engineer siamo alla ricerca di un software engineer talentuoso per unirsi al team a calenzano, firenze... responsabilità: progettare e sviluppare soluzioni software ed elettroniche all'avanguardia... requisiti: laurea in ingegneria informatica o titolo equivalente......

Advanced Software Engineer Salesforce Service Cloud
Sincrono Formazione Srl

Ruolo ricoperto:-advanced software engineer salesforce service cloudcompetenze richieste:-salesforce service cloudseniority: + 5 annisede di lavoro: milano, roma e napoli: preferibile residenza su milano (on-site)impegno: full time dal lunedì al venerdìsi offre:contratto e retribuzione commisurata alla......

Advanced Software Engineer
Sincrono Formazione Srl

Ruolo ricoperto:-advanced software engineercompetenze richieste:-java-apache tomcat-jboss application serverrequisiti linguistici:-inglese: livello b1seniority: +5 annisede di lavoro: roma ( sw parziale)impegno: full time dal lunedì al venerdìsi offre:contratto e retribuzione commisurata alla reale esperienza......

Expert Software Engineer
Sincrono Formazione Srl

Ruolo ricoperto:-expert software engineercompetenze richieste:-node js-aws-serverless framework-aws lambdaseniority: + 2 annisede di lavoro: roma ( sw totale)impegno: full time dal lunedì al venerdìsi offre:contratto e retribuzione commisurata alla reale esperienza del candidato......

Advanced Software Engineer
Sincrono Formazione Srl

Gruppo sincrono, holding company ict di consulenza e formazione che opera sul mercato dal 1993, sta selezionando per un'importante opportunità professionale per un nostro cliente presente su firenze, un advanced software engineer, l'attività sarà svolta in smart working parziale, *il candidato verrà......

Software Engineer Java
Sincrono Formazione Srl

Ruolo ricoperto:-software engineer javacompetenze richieste:-opensearch e/o elasticsearch-java 11+-architetture containerizzate e orchestrazione (kubernetes, ecc... gruppo sincrono, holding company ict di consulenza e formazione che opera sul mercato dal 1993, sta selezionando per un'importante opportunità......

Software Engineer
Ariadne srl

Siamo alla ricerca di software engineers e talenti che hanno concluso o sono al termine di un percorso universitario e che desiderano essere coinvolti in nuovi sfidanti progetti, tecnologicamente avanzati e con la possibilità di esplorare le più moderne tecnologie... ariadne fa parte del gruppo dgs una......

Cercasi dipendente programmatore software & hardware
Matex elettronica.

Esperto in elettronica hardware e software... al cellulare…n° 335314926 leonardo settore : informatica - telecomunicazioni – hardware e software elettronico... ))) con conoscenza windows e linux , ed elettronica applicata- ecc,ecc, settore: informatica - telecomunicazioni - hardware e software e sistemi......

Middle Software Developer
Intesi S.r.l.

Intesi srl, software house leader del mercato erp dedicato a molteplici settori della meccanica di precisione, dello stampaggio e della carpenteria leggera e pesante, con sede in niviano (pc), ricerca e seleziona per ampliamento proprio organico: middle software developer requisiti di lavoro requisiti......